What is B02B0?
DTC B02B0 is a diagnostic trouble code that indicates a fault within the Body Control Module (BCM) of your vehicle. The BCM is a crucial component responsible for controlling various electronic systems in your car, such as power windows, door locks, and lighting. When the BCM detects a malfunction or an issue with its internal circuits, it triggers the B02B0 code. This can lead to a range of electrical problems, including failure of the power door locks to operate properly, irregular lighting, or even issues with the vehicle’s security system. In real-world situations, you might notice that your vehicle’s lights malfunction, or the key fob fails to unlock the doors. Ignoring this code can lead to more severe electrical issues and affect overall vehicle performance, so addressing it promptly is vital for maintaining your vehicle's reliability and functionality.

Possible Causes
Most common causes of B02B0 (ordered by frequency):
- The most common cause of B02B0 is a faulty Body Control Module, with a likelihood of around 60%. This could be due to internal circuit failures or software glitches.
- A second possible cause is damaged wiring or poor connections to the BCM, which can disrupt communication. This is typically seen in vehicles with higher mileage.
- Corrosion at the BCM connectors can lead to intermittent failures, so regular inspections can help prevent this.
- Less common but serious causes include water intrusion into the BCM area, which can cause significant electronic failures.
- A rare cause could be a failing ignition switch, which can affect multiple electronic systems, including the BCM.

Real Repair Case Studies
Case Study 1: BCM Replacement on 2016 Chevrolet Silverado 1500
Vehicle: 2016 Chevrolet Silverado 1500, 75,000 miles
Problem: Customer reported that the power door locks failed to operate and the interior lights flickered intermittently.
Diagnosis: After scanning with GeekOBD, B02B0 was confirmed. A visual inspection revealed a faulty BCM.
Solution: Replaced the Body Control Module with a new unit and performed a system test to ensure functionality.
Cost: $650 (parts: $500, labor: $150)
Result: All electrical systems returned to normal operation, and the issue was resolved.
Case Study 2: Wiring Repair on 2018 GMC Sierra 1500
Vehicle: 2018 GMC Sierra 1500, 50,000 miles
Problem: Customer experienced problems with the key fob not unlocking the doors and erratic lighting.
Diagnosis: Diagnostic scan confirmed B02B0, and inspection found damaged wiring connected to the BCM.
Solution: Repaired the damaged wiring and ensured secure connections to the BCM.
Cost: $200 (parts: $50, labor: $150)
Result: The electrical issues were resolved, and the vehicle operated normally afterward.
